I decided to swap my Ryzen 5 2600 for a Ryzen 7 3700x. The system will not turn on, its like there's no power at all, the only thing lit is the GPU led when the PSU is switched on. Replacing the 2600 and it fires up as normal. I tried a 3600 which also works as normal. Put 3700x back in, nada. The mobo is an MSI B450M pro m2 max. Said to support this cpu, and works ok with the Ryzen 5 3600. The cpu looks fine. all pins appear ok. I quickly benched up my msi x570 gaming plus (the crap one) with a new tt grand 650w psu. Same problem. Wont work with the 3700x. Is there something specific I need to do with a Ryzen 7 3700x that could cause this problem , or, is the cpu dead?

During CPU replacement, you must reset the CMOS. If it doesn’t work, erase the CMOS, install the 2600, and then refresh the BIOS.
